Port St. Lucie Lowers Tax Rate Amid Budget Increase

In a surprising yet welcoming move, the city of Port St. Lucie has set a tentative millage decrease while announcing a substantial increase in the city budget. This decision exemplifies a strategic balancing act aimed at maintaining fiscal responsibility and fostering city development.

Understanding the Millage Rate Decrease

The term “millage rate” refers to the amount per $1,000 of property value that is used to calculate local property taxes. A decrease in the millage rate means homeowners in Port St. Lucie can expect to pay less in property taxes, even as the city’s overall budget expands.
